Seven dead, 11 injured in Lagos-Ibadan expressway crash

Seven people were reported killed and eleven others sustaining serious injuries in a road accident which occurred at about 9.33p.m. on Monday night at Ogere along the Lagos-Ibadan expressway, as a result of poor visibility cause by rain.

Penpushing reports that the Public Education Officer, Federal Road Safety Commission (FRSC), Ogun State Command, Florence Okpe, confirmed this in a statement adding that that the accident involved a truck with no registration number and a Mazda bus, with registration number MNY894 YN.

The Command Public Education Officer in the statement stated that the injured victims had been taken to PATMAG Hospital, Ogere, for medical attention while the corpses were deposited at FOS morgue, Ipara.

Penpushing further reports that the command cautioned motorists to shun excessive speed and use speed limits, especially at night and during the rain due to poor visibility, and sympathised with the family of the crash victims with advice for passengers to always be on the alert to correct some mistakes of the drivers.

The statement in a related development said a team from Federal Road Safety Corps (FRSC) Ibafo Command carried out a rescue operation at an accident scene at Kara at the Berger end of the Lagos-Ibadan expressway.

‘The crash, which occurred at about 0530hrs, involved two vehicles with the following details: A blue Peugeot bus with registration number WRA224XA and an Orange DAF Truck with registration number ANC711XA. Four people were involved in the crash. Two people died, the injured victims were taken to the nearest hospital, while the corpses were handed over to the family members’, the statement said.
